Output 17ec370d10a6e381c04b0e6a7a46bb299eb67186b68aa4e1cccbc796238310fa:0

value
15590390
script pubkey
OP_HASH160 OP_PUSHBYTES_20 034cf337aa0bb699b6172dc33e2484947445b99e OP_EQUAL
address
31zU8hmXuH538HTCh8BUYy1WSeu64SfegM
transaction
17ec370d10a6e381c04b0e6a7a46bb299eb67186b68aa4e1cccbc796238310fa